The Patriots Sunday, claimed their third straight win beating the Carolina Panthers 24-6. It is the 5th win this season for the Patriots as rookie QB, Mac Jones is starting to show just how much grit he truly has.
In the second quarter is when the Patriots came to life in this game with Harris and Henry both catching passes from Jones and getting the two touchdowns that the Patriots needed to close the second quarter 14-6 against the Panthers who had just a TD and a field goal.
In the third quarter, J.C. Jackson had a big interception and then took it 88 yards for a TD. Folk made a 37 yard field goal and the at the end of the third quarter it was 24-6 Patriots lead.
The Patriots defense held firm Sunday which limited the Panthers offense who showed no sign of life on the clock in much of this contest. Jackson had two interceptions and one TD while Collins had one interception.
The Patriots will close the book on week nine with three straight wins for rookie QB Mac Jones. Next week, week ten the Patriots will return home to Gillette Stadium and host the Cleveland Browns.
